This PR wires pagination and filter chips into the Ledgerglass audit-log viewer. Nothing scary: the query layer now streams in pages instead of slurping the whole table, and the export button respects active filters. Heads up for release notes — admins will notice the new default page size. I also pulled the retry and cache knobs out of the code into one config block so we stop hand-editing them per deploy. Current values are as follows.

constants for kageg-bawif:
QUOTAS = {
    "quenwyn": 1,
    "oliix": 10,
}

## Runbook: Turnstile Counter Account Recovery (Garnet Bowl)

Applies to the Gatecount service at Garnet Bowl stadium. If the operator account locks out, counters keep tallying locally but stop syncing. Do not reimage the gateway. Steps: confirm local buffer is healthy, stop the sync daemon, run `gatecount recover --operator`, then restart sync. The recovery prompt asks for the passphrase, which is:

unlock words, hahip-baduf: holwyn-istath-julvan

## Deploying the Gatewick Proctor Queue

Deploys are pretty painless: push to main, wait for the pipeline, then watch the queue drain dashboard for five minutes. If candidates pile up mid-exam, roll back first and ask questions later — the queue replays safely. Everything the workers care about lives in one config block, shown here for reference.

settings of bafof-yagef:
JOROX_PIN=8740
JOROX_TENANT=pelox
JOROX_METRICS_HOST=metrics.jorox.qorvelworks.internal
JOROX_SEAL=seal_c78f63c1
JOROX_STANDBY_TEAM=norax